[Draught at the restaurant] Funny place for a brewery. If it wasn’t for the sign "fresh beer" I wouldn’t have guessed that they had a brewery inside the restaurant (actually the lagering tanks were on display in another section of the restaurant, called "Beijing Roast Duck", I believe) Well, the beer came absolutely pitch black with small beige head. The aroma held generous amonuts of chocoalate and some licorice. It was medium bodied with rounded mouthfeel. Chocolate dominates, but there are notes of tar as well. Full flavoured with medium bitterness. As enjoyable as the superb Chongqing Chicken here, and at around a 5th of the price of the beers at Paulaner 300m away a bargain.
